X-Radiation
Discovery, Properties and Applications
They are enormously rich in energy and easily penetrate the body but in spite of this, we can neither see nor feel them: X-rays work in secret. Because of their physical properties we owe important advances in medicine to them. Their ability to see through the body and make bone and tissue structures visible allows us to diagnose fractures or diseases without opening the body. X-rays, artificially generated in an X-ray tube, are ionising like radioactive radiation and can impair the functions of body cells. Therefore, the use of X-rays is subject to strict regulations because benefits and possible harmful effects, above all of X-ray examinations and radiotherapy, must be carefully weighed up.

Ceramic
Ceramics are indispensable in our everyday lives. We eat from ceramic plates, drink from ceramic cups, use tiled ceramic bathrooms. But how is ceramic manufactured? The film reveals the secrets of this fascinating material! We get to know more about the beginnings of ceramic in the Old World of Egypt and Mesopotamia, about Greece, China and Rome. We gain interesting insights into the valuable earthenware and are also shown the exquisite further development of the "white gold". Today this versatile material is irreplaceable in industry, too. Whether in space or as an easily compatible substitute in medicine, ceramic is applied in many places.
